General Information

The purpose of the Air Conditioning (A/C) system is to provide cool air and remove humidity from the interior of the vehicle. The vehicle operator can activate the A/C system by pressing the A/C switch. The A/C system can operate regardless of the temperature setting. A/C is available as long as ambient air temperatures are above 4°C (40°F). When the vehicle operator presses the A/C switch, voltage is sent to the PCM through the A/C request signal circuit. When the PCM reads voltage on this circuit, the module knows that an A/C request has been made. The PCM will command on the A/C compressor clutch to help reduce moisture inside the vehicle. The A/C compressor is on in selected
modes, even in cool weather conditions, to help eliminate moisture from fogging the windshield. The A/C LED will not illuminate unless the driver presses the A/C request switch on the HVAC control module. Otherwise, the A/C system may be running without the A/C LED indicator illuminated.

The PCM turns on the A/C compressor by providing a path to ground through the A/C compressor clutch relay control circuit for the A/C compressor clutch relay. Power is provided to the A/C compressor clutch relay from the underhood fuse block. Once the relay closes its internal switch, power is provided to the A/C compressor clutch through the A/C compressor clutch supply voltage circuit. Whenever the compressor is turned off, the A/C compressor clutch diode prevents a voltage spike from burning up the compressor clutch coil. The ground circuit provides a path to ground for the compressor and relay. The A/C clutch relay control circuit is grounded internally within the PCM.

The PCM will engage the A/C compressor clutch any time the engine speed is below 5000 RPM and the A/C is requested unless any of the following conditions exist:
^ Throttle angle is at 100 percent (WOT).
^ Vehicle launch, acceleration from a stop.
^ Idle quality
^ The A/C refrigerant pressure sensor is more than 2979 kPa (432 psi) or is less than 186 kPa (27 psi).
^ Engine speed is more than 5500 RPM.
^ Engine coolant temperature (ECT) is more than 124°C (255°F) for the LG8 and 121°C (250°F) for the L36.
^ Transmission shift
^ Engine torque load
